Description

A clean conical roof, ready to cap a tower. True to its French name — *toiture droite*, a straight roof — this is a simple, smooth cone with a flared eaves lip at the bottom and a small chimney-like nub at the peak. There is no shingle texture or ornament; it is a crisp geometric roof form meant to sit atop a round tower, turret or hut. It drops into model-village, wargaming-terrain and model-railway projects, or works as a stand-alone lid, finial or planter cap for anyone who just wants a tidy cone. Because the surface is plain, the print itself carries the quality here — smooth walls matter far more than fine detail. Print notes • Print it point-up, hollow, straight off the bed — the cone is self-supporting, so no supports are needed and the flared rim lays down first. • Use vase mode or 2–3 perimeters for a fast, light roof; 0.2 mm layers are fine, or 0.12 mm for an almost seamless slope. • The apex nub prints cleanest with a slightly slower top-layer speed to avoid a blob. • Prime and paint terracotta, slate grey or verdigris to match the building it crowns; a quick sand erases layer lines before paint.
